Top 5 Play Pass Games Performance in the United States, Q4 2023
Explore the performance of the top 5 Play Pass games in the United States during Q4 2023, including tr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users.
The fourth quarter of 2023 has been an eventful period for the top 5 Play Pass games in the United States. Here’s an in-depth look at how these games performed across downloads, revenue, and weekly active users,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Disney Coloring World witnessed significant growth in several areas. Downloads saw a strong upward trend, starting at around 10K in late September and peaking at approximately 39K by the end of December. Revenue followed a similar positive trajectory, peaking at about $79K towards the end of October. Weekly active users also showed a substantial increase, rising from around 41K in late September to approximately 67K by the end of December.
LEGO® DUPLO® WORLD had a dynamic quarter as well. Downloads experienced notable peaks, especially towards the end of December, reaching around 14K. Revenue saw fluctuations but maintained a general downward trend, starting at approximately $81K in late September and ending at around $41K in December. Weekly active users saw a slight decline from about 24K to around 26K over the quarter.
Hungry Shark Evolution displayed consistent performance. Downloads remained relatively stable, with minor fluctuations, peaking at approximately 62K in the last week of December. Revenue also showed stability with minor increases, ending the quarter at about $33K. Weekly active users maintained a steady presence, starting at around 249K and peaking at approximately 259K by the end of December.
Pixel Art - Color by Number saw impressive growth in downloads, which surged from around 31K in late September to around 78K by the end of December. Revenue remained stable, hovering around $23K. Weekly active users saw significant growth, peaking at approximately 933K in late November and ending the quarter at about 782K.
Flow Free experienced remarkable performance in Q4 2023. Downloads saw a substantial increase, starting at around 40K and peaking at approximately 106K by the end of December. Revenue showed a consistent upward trend, ending at about $23K. Weekly active users also saw significant growth, reaching a peak of approximately 2.4M in mid-November.
